## Baseline Tuning

The Grimshaw analyzer compares findings against `baseline.lock`. New issues fail the build; baseline entries are grandfathered but decay over time. Regenerate the baseline only after triage, never to silence a page. If churn exceeds the drift cap, the job alerts on-call. Current knobs are listed below.

tuning table, faduf-baduf:
PRIORITIES = {
    "ulavan": 191,
    "silys": 750,
    "goriel": 238,
    "kelmir": 66,
    "wendor": 432,
}

## Dedup Capacity Note — Kestrelwatch

Plugin authors: the Kestrelwatch alert deduplicator now shards by fingerprint, not source. Expect per-plugin throughput caps. Current headroom is 40% at peak; we project exhaustion in Q3 if plugin fan-out doubles. Batch your emissions. Do not retry on 429 inside the dedup window; it resets the suppression timer and burns quota. Window sizes and burst allowances are fixed platform-wide and not negotiable per plugin. Effective limits are as follows:

tuning table, yajog-yahof:
BUDGETS = {
    "lamvan": 303,
    "wenox": 460,
    "fenvan": 525,
}

Subject: SeatScape renderer 2.4 — release notes

Hi all, and welcome to Priya, our new contractor on the Marlowe Hall project. This build of the SeatScape renderer fixes the balcony-row offset bug and adds zoom-level caching for large venues. Please test against the Orpheline Theatre fixture before approving, since its curved mezzanine exercises the worst-case geometry path. Accessibility seat icons now render at all zoom levels. The build token for verification appears below.

build token for tahop-fafof: htk14_2d55df8101eccc

Ticket: Pooler vault locked after restart

The Brindlewood connection pooler (pgFerry) refuses new database connections because its credentials vault re-locked during last night's patch window. As a new contractor, please do not restart the service again — that resets the unlock timer. Instead, run the unseal command on the primary node and enter the passphrase provided below.

unlock words, tawif-tahop: oliys-ulawyn-tamdor-lamys-casox-jormir-fraius-kasath-ulador-ulamir-holir-sorys-holeth